I have had 3 herniated discs repaired and this is how I feel each time:
pain radiated down my leg and into foot.
no dull pain in my back at all.
the niggle changed to tingling and numbness sometimes.
Could not straighten my leg that was effected when sitting in the hip bath or on the floor. Felt like the muscles in the back of my leg be tight and too short.
The pain that went down my leg almost felt close to jolts of electricity.
When I layed on my back I could lift my leg up but if I relaxed and someone else did it, it was excruciating. Weird, yes.
Had trouble sitting for any length of time, again, aching down my thigh, into leg and down to foot.
